Labels

Freak

Freak is about being strange, different, unusual. It's about being abnormal, weird, uncanny, odd, disturbing, upsetting. It's about being unique, powerful, special, individual, interesting. Being beautiful, extraordinary, and a good kind of different.

Freak is used to unleash your powers.

Danger

Danger is about being scary, frightening, intimidating, threatening. It's about being destructive, deadly, fearsome, explosive, and dangerous. It's about being strong, powerful, dangerous, a weapon, a soldier, a thug.

Danger is used to directly engage a threat.

Savior

Savior is about being a martyr, a boy scout, a goody two shoes. It's about being responsible, noble, hopeful, helpful, naïve, obedient. It's about being protective and heroic; a guardian and a rescuer.

Savior is used to defend.

Superior

Superior is about being better than them, smarter than them. It's about being right, correct, intelligent, clever, stubborn, type A. It's about being a leader, someone who's going places, most likely to succeed, and annoying.

Superior is used to assess the situation and provoke someone.

Mundane

Mundane is about being human, empathetic, sympathetic, kind, understanding. It's about being unremarkable, average, unidentifiable, normal, regular, invisible, plain, standard issue. It's about being emotionally healthy, capable of connecting, capable of supporting others.

Mundane is used to comfort or support and pierce someone's mask.
